‘I met a traveller from an antique land’ A solo exhibition by Emirati artist ALYAZIA BINT NAHYAN curated by Janet Rady.

Alyazia Bint Nahyan connects – things and people. And the title ‘I met a traveller from an antique land’, which she has chosen for the exhibition subtly reflects these connections. Its significance comes from the fact that it is the first line of the poem Ozymandias by Percy Bysshe Shelley, in which the 18th century poet ponders on the greatness of ancient Egypt viewed by the travellers of his day.

Drawing on this analogy, Alyazia’s work pursues connections with ancient civilisations / customs and traditions with more modern mores, so bringing together the past and the present. The exhibition mixes verses of poetry she has specifically selected from a variety of well-known Arab and Western poets with her own works, to underpin her theme of connecting.
